Step One: Find A Low Code App Builder The truth is, you don’t need to be a developer to build an app anymore. With a low code or no-code app builder, basically, anyone has the power to build an app on their own. You just have to decide what app builder to use, and then you are good to go. The main decision here is between a low code app builder and a no code app builder. A no-code platform lets you develop an app without requiring any code. So instead of writing code, you can add content to the app screen and have it updated in real-time. This sounds great, but the one catch is you can’t bring in any of your own code to further personalize the app. Low code app development platforms on the other hand leaves room for a little more flexibility. A low code platform still lets you build an app from beginning to end with no code required. But it also leaves the option open for users to bring their own custom code in. Step Two: Pick an App to Build The next step is to decide what kind of app you are going to build. This step kind of two-fold. One, you have to decide what the purpose of your app is going to be, what it is going to look like, etc. This is the stuff that is more obvious. But you also have to decide what kind of app you want to build. Now, don’t freak out if you didn’t even know there was more than one type of app, you aren’t the only one. Native Mobile App For a long time native mobile apps have been the cornerstone of apps. When you first think of an app, this is probably what you think of. You download them from the app store and they are compatible with the hardware of your phone which improves functionality. However, they also take much longer to build, are more expensive, and you have to build separate apps for Android and iOS devices. So while native mobile apps might sound like the creme de la creme in theory, they aren’t as great as meets the eye. Progressive Web App The other choice here is a Progressive Web App (PWA). A PWA is an evolution of the standard web app. Basically it is an app that is hosted through the web, but a PWA is installable to your home screen so it will look, feel, and run like a native mobile app. It is a great way to get the native app feel, which customers like, but take away all of the other roadblocks, like the need to download, development time, and cost.
